What companies run services between St. Johann in Tirol, Austria and Novi Sad, Serbia?

Luki Reisen operates a bus from St.Johann in Tirol to Novi Sad, Autobuska Stanica 3 times a week. Tickets cost RSD 5,500–10,000 and the journey takes 13h 30m. King Line also services this route once a week. Alternatively, you can take a train from St. Johann In Tirol to Petrovaradin via Woergl Hbf, Wien Hbf, Koebanya-Kispest, Szeged, and Subotica in around 15h 16m.
